c++ - 适用于 Windows Media Foundation 的 Visual Studio

标签 c++ c visual-studio ms-media-foundation

我打算使用 Windows Media Function 构建示例应用程序,但我对需要使用的 Visual Studio 版本感到困惑。还有我如何从这个示例应用程序开始。我是否需要下载 Windows Developer SDK 来构建此示例?还有我需要使用什么工具来构建 UI 组件。

我想构建用于播放本地视频文件的示例应用程序。

最佳答案

要使用 Media Foundation API 开发经典/桌面应用程序,使用最简单版本的 Visual Studio 就足够了,例如Visual Studio 2015 Community Edition连同 Windows 10 SDK (不要被标题中的“Windows 10”混淆,适当构建的应用程序可以在 Windows XP 和更新版本中运行)。您将不得不在 7.1 版之前的旧 Windows SDK 版本中查找桌面应用程序示例,因为版本 8 它们被省略了(后来它们被放在网上 here )。同时还有newer Media Foundation samples以 Windows 10 UWP 应用程序的格式提供,您也可以使用上述工具集构建它们。

关于c++ - 适用于 Windows Media Foundation 的 Visual Studio,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/42197754/

相关文章:

c++ - 将静态全局变量声明为内联是否有意义?

c - 为什么 timelocal 和 mktime 无法正确处理夏令时?

c# - 从表中检索数据以确认记录是否存在时如何修复 "Specified Cast Is Not Valid"错误?

visual-studio - VS2017 缺少“管理 NuGet 包”对话框

c - 不明确的运算符优先级,请解释为什么这里不遵循运算符优先级?

c# - 抑制模块加载的 JIT 优化(仅限托管)

c++ - Jsonxx - 迭代 Json

c++ - windows mp3 解码库 c c++

c++ - 将字符数组转换为 std::string 以传递到 std::bitset 段错误

memmove()的代码